This practice of libeling political opponents, will often drive the best men from public stations, or prevent them from accepting offices ; it will generate the most violent animosities between men who have a common interest in the public welfare, and a common attachment to republican forms of government ; it will sometimes degrade or render odious the good, and exalt the had to popularity and to offices of honor, which they will dishonor by their vices or their weakness. Many of our public evi
...ls may be traced to deception practiced upon the people, by calumny and misrepresentations. A majority of our citizens have, in some cases, been wholly mistaken in the characters and designs of their favorite leaders, as well as in the true policy of their measures. Some of these mistakes will last during the present generation ; others may be dissipated by the public mischief which they produce.
Of mistakes which pervade a large portion of the community, several instances may be mentioned ; but I shall specify one instance only, which is often a theme of declamation and abuse : this is a misapprehen- sion of the origin and design of the Hartford Convention.^ I mention this, because I was personally concerned, in the origination of it, and am acquainted with every measure that preceded it, and with the men who were the authors of it.
